Reconomy Connect is seeking a Corporate Business Development Executive to join their Construction and Infrastructure team in Telford. This role focuses on building strong relationships with blue-chip organizations and developing sustainable business solutions.
Candidates should possess strong communication skills, a proactive attitude, and a proven track record in sales. The position requires regular travel across the UK, along with working remotely when not on the road.
Reconomy Connect offers a competitive benefits package, including financial perks, health and wellbeing support, and generous holiday allowances.

Before the interview, make sure you research Reconomy Connect thoroughly. Understand their business model, values, and recent projects in the construction and infrastructure sector.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.
✨Showcase Your Sales Skills
Prepare specific examples from your past experiences that highlight your sales achievements.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ses. This will demonstrate your proven track record in sales and how you can bring value to their team.
